Had a d2650fd come in the shop with a busted oil pan, there seem to be bolts behind the clutch holding it on that you have to split the tractor to access, is this the case? And if so, WHOS STUPID IDEA WAS THAT?! Also, any suggestions for a possible replacement? Thanks in advance.
 
/ D2650fd #2  
The only Mitsubishi engine I've personally known of that was designed that way was a Mitsubishi S4S-D in a Montana 5740. I have never had the pan off a K4E but maybe it is of that design too. Looking at parts diagrams for it, it doesn't "appear" that any bolts are inaccessible from underneath but maybe so? A new pan will probably be next to impossible to find, short of searching salvage parts for equipment that used that engine. Part number is MM412649 and a diagram for both style pans is available here Adex International Inc. - Mitsubishi Parts. West KY Tractor Parts has a salvage 2650 in stock.
